Broken links can kill your site's credibility, frustrate visitors, and damage your SEO—but how do you find them if you’re not using WordPress? What if you're website is a HTML website or on Wix, Squarespace or Shopify? Fortunately, powerful tools like Google Search Console, Ahrefs, and SEMrush can help automate the process of identifying broken or dead links on any site.
📌 In this episode, Charly walks you through:
✅ How Google Search Console reports broken links
✅ Where to find crawl errors and link issues in Ahrefs and SEMrush
✅ The difference between internal and external broken links
✅ Why fixing broken links is crucial for SEO and user experience
🛠️ You’ll get a high-level view of automated broken link detection—so you can stay on top of your site's health and performance, even without WordPress.

If your Zoho Mail calendar isn’t showing the Zoom option even after enabling it in the admin console — there’s one more step you can’t skip. In this follow-up to Episode 561, Charly explains exactly what each user needs to do to activate Zoom meetings in their Zoho calendar.
📌 In this episode, Charly walks you through:
✅ Why enabling Zoom in the Zoho admin console isn’t enough
✅ The user-level setting that unlocks Zoom in the calendar
✅ How to authenticate individual Zoom accounts inside Zoho Mail
✅ What to check if Zoom still doesn’t appear as an option
🛡️ Each user must authenticate Zoom in their own Zoho settings — it’s mandatory.
